Why is the Sky So High? is a Nigerian tale devised over a one week period with young people in Huddersfield about why the sky, which originally provided food for all the people on the earth, was taken away. It will be led by musicians (songwriters, singers, instrumentalists and performers), Mary Keith and Hugh Nankivell, along with writer Stephanie Bowgett and shadow puppeteer and mask maker Joe King including community members.
